CVE-2023-52173
CVE-2023-52173
Weakness (CWE)
CVSS Vector
v3.1- Attack Vector
- Network
- Attack Complexity
- Low
- Privileges Required
- None
- User Interaction
- None
- Scope
- Unchanged
- Confidentiality
- High
- Integrity
- High
- Availability
- High
Description
XnView Classic before 2.51.3 on Windows has a Write Access Violation at xnview.exe+0x3ADBD0.
Comprehensive Technical Analysis of CVE-2023-52173
1. Vulnerability Assessment and Severity Evaluation
CVE ID: CVE-2023-52173
Description: XnView Classic before version 2.51.3 on Windows has a Write Access Violation at xnview.exe+0x3ADBD0.
CVSS Score: 9.8
Severity Evaluation: The CVSS score of 9.8 indicates a critical vulnerability. This high score is likely due to the potential for remote code execution, the ease of exploitation, and the significant impact on system integrity and confidentiality.
2. Potential Attack Vectors and Exploitation Methods
Attack Vectors:
- Malicious File Handling: An attacker could craft a specially designed file that, when opened by XnView Classic, triggers the write access violation.
- Phishing: Users could be tricked into downloading and opening malicious files through phishing emails or malicious websites.
Exploitation Methods:
- Buffer Overflow: The write access violation suggests a buffer overflow condition, where an attacker could overwrite memory locations, potentially leading to arbitrary code execution.
- Remote Code Execution (RCE): If successfully exploited, the vulnerability could allow an attacker to execute arbitrary code on the affected system.
3. Affected Systems and Software Versions
Affected Software:
- XnView Classic versions before 2.51.3 on Windows.
Affected Systems:
- Any Windows system running the vulnerable versions of XnView Classic.
4. Recommended Mitigation Strategies
Immediate Actions:
- Update Software: Upgrade to XnView Classic version 2.51.3 or later, which addresses this vulnerability.
- Disable Automatic File Opening: Configure the system to prompt users before opening files from untrusted sources.
Long-Term Strategies:
- User Education: Train users to recognize and avoid phishing attempts and suspicious files.
- Network Segmentation: Implement network segmentation to limit the spread of potential threats.
- Regular Patching: Ensure that all software, including XnView Classic, is regularly updated to the latest versions.
5. Impact on Cybersecurity Landscape
Immediate Impact:
- Increased Risk: Organizations using XnView Classic are at increased risk of exploitation, which could lead to data breaches, system compromises, and loss of sensitive information.
- Reputation Damage: Successful exploitation could result in reputational damage for affected organizations.
Long-Term Impact:
- Enhanced Security Measures: This vulnerability highlights the need for robust security practices, including regular patching, user education, and proactive threat detection.
- Industry Awareness: Increased awareness within the cybersecurity community about the importance of timely vulnerability disclosures and patch management.
6. Technical Details for Security Professionals
Technical Analysis:
- Memory Corruption: The write access violation indicates a memory corruption issue, likely due to improper bounds checking or buffer management.
- Exploit Development: An attacker could develop an exploit by crafting a file that triggers the memory corruption, allowing for code execution.
Detection and Response:
- Intrusion Detection Systems (IDS): Implement IDS to detect unusual file access patterns and potential exploitation attempts.
- Log Monitoring: Monitor system logs for any unusual activity related to XnView Classic, such as unexpected crashes or error messages.
- Incident Response Plan: Develop and maintain an incident response plan to quickly address any potential exploitation of this vulnerability.
References:
By addressing this vulnerability promptly and implementing robust security measures, organizations can mitigate the risks associated with CVE-2023-52173 and enhance their overall cybersecurity posture.